Lever altered, adjusted (7)

Ross

I believe the answer is:

treadle

'lever' is the definition.
(treadle is a kind of lever)

'altered adjusted' is the wordplay.
'adjusted' indicates anagramming the letters.
'altered' with letters rearranged gives 'TREADLE'.
